Understanding Crochet Hairstyles
Before diving into the selection process, it is essential to understand what crochet hairstyles are. Crochet hairstyles involve using a crochet hook to attach hair extensions to your natural hair. This technique allows for a variety of styles, textures, and lengths.
Crochet hairstyles can be made from synthetic or human hair, giving you flexibility in terms of budget and appearance. The beauty of crochet is that it can mimic natural hair textures, making it a popular choice for many.
Consider Your Face Shape
One of the first things to consider when choosing a crochet hairstyle is your face shape. Different styles can complement or contrast your features. Here are some common face shapes and suitable crochet styles:
Oval Face: Almost any crochet style works well. You can experiment with long, short, curly, or straight styles.
Round Face: Opt for styles that add height, such as long, layered crochet braids. Avoid styles that add width.
Square Face: Soft, wavy styles can help soften the angles of your face. Consider medium-length crochet curls.
Heart-Shaped Face: Styles that add volume around the chin, like bob cuts or loose curls, can balance your features.
Understanding your face shape can guide you in selecting a crochet hairstyle that enhances your natural beauty.
Assess Your Hair Type
Your natural hair type plays a significant role in determining the best crochet hairstyle for you. Different textures and densities can affect how well a style holds up. Here are some tips based on hair type:
Fine Hair: Choose lightweight crochet styles that won’t weigh your hair down. Loose curls or waves can add volume without being too heavy.
Thick Hair: You can handle heavier styles, such as chunky braids or large curls. These styles can add drama and flair.
Curly Hair: Embrace your natural texture with crochet styles that mimic your curls. This can create a seamless look.
Straight Hair: Consider adding curls or waves with crochet extensions to create more dimension and interest.
By assessing your hair type, you can choose a crochet hairstyle that works harmoniously with your natural texture.

Choosing the Right Color
Color can dramatically change the look of your crochet hairstyle. When selecting a color, consider your skin tone and personal preferences. Here are some tips for choosing the right color:
Warm Skin Tones: Colors like honey blonde, auburn, or warm browns can complement your complexion.
Cool Skin Tones: Opt for shades like ash blonde, jet black, or cool browns to enhance your features.
Bold Choices: If you love to stand out, consider vibrant colors like blue, purple, or red. These can add a unique flair to your crochet hairstyle.
Experimenting with color can be a fun way to express yourself. Just remember to choose shades that make you feel confident and beautiful.
Maintenance and Care
Once you have chosen your crochet hairstyle, it is essential to consider maintenance and care. Proper care can extend the life of your crochet style and keep your hair healthy. Here are some tips for maintaining your crochet hairstyle:
Keep Your Scalp Clean: Regularly cleanse your scalp to prevent buildup. Use a gentle shampoo and avoid heavy products.
Moisturize: Keep your natural hair moisturized to prevent dryness. Use lightweight oils or leave-in conditioners.
Protect at Night: Use a satin or silk scarf to protect your crochet hairstyle while you sleep. This can help reduce frizz and maintain your style.
Limit Heat: Avoid excessive heat styling on your crochet extensions. If you must use heat, apply a heat protectant.
By following these maintenance tips, you can keep your crochet hairstyle looking fresh and vibrant.
